Pārlūkot izejas kodu

Update footer, minor changes to /about styling.

Add:
        static/sass/main.sass
                -Rework the footer, which is now fixed at the bottom of the
                screen as opposed to floored to the bottom of the page.
                Positioning at the bottom of the page doesn't make any sense
                with a technically infinite results page.
tags/v1.0^2
Severyn Kozak pirms 10 gadiem
vecāks
revīzija
2cc5be8737
6 mainītis faili ar 24 papildinājumiem un 13 dzēšanām
  1. Binārs
     
  2. +1
    -1
      static/js/about.js
  3. +0
    -1
      static/js/index.js
  4. +4
    -0
      static/sass/_mixins.sass
  5. +10
    -8
      static/sass/about.sass
  6. +9
    -3
      static/sass/main.sass

Binārs
Parādīt failu


+ 1
- 1
static/js/about.js Parādīt failu

@@ -4,7 +4,7 @@ function parallax(){
var currVertPos = $(window).scrollTop();
var delta = currVertPos - lastVertPos;
$(".bg").each(function(){
$(this).css("top", parseFloat($(this).css("top")) - delta * 1.35 + "px");
$(this).css("top", parseFloat($(this).css("top")) - delta * 1.8 + "px");
});
lastVertPos = currVertPos;
}


+ 0
- 1
static/js/index.js Parādīt failu

@@ -138,7 +138,6 @@ var searchResultsPage = 1;

//Obtained by parsing python file with pygments
var codeExample = '<table class="highlighttable"><tr><td class="linenos"><div class="linenodiv"><pre> 1\n 2\n 3\n 4\n 5\n 6\n 7\n 8\n 9\n10\n11\n12\n13\n14\n15\n16\n17\n18\n19\n20\n21\n22\n23\n24\n25\n26\n27\n28\n29\n30\n31\n32\n33\n34\n35\n36\n37\n38\n39\n40</pre></div></td><td class="code"><div class="highlight"><pre><span class="sd">&quot;&quot;&quot;</span>\n<span class="sd">Module to contain all the project&#39;s Flask server plumbing.</span>\n<span class="sd">&quot;&quot;&quot;</span>\n\n<span class="kn">from</span> <span class="nn">flask</span> <span class="kn">import</span> <span class="n">Flask</span>\n<span class="kn">from</span> <span class="nn">flask</span> <span class="kn">import</span> <span class="n">render_template</span><span class="p">,</span> <span class="n">session</span>\n\n<span class="kn">from</span> <span class="nn">bitshift</span> <span class="kn">import</span> <span class="n">assets</span>\n<span class="c"># from bitshift.database import Database</span>\n<span class="c"># from bitshift.query import parse_query</span>\n\n<span class="hll"><span class="n">app</span> <span class="o">=</span> <span class="n">Flask</span><span class="p">(</span><span class="n">__name__</span><span class="p">)</span>\n</span><span class="hll"><span class="n">app</span><span class="o">.</span><span class="n">config</span><span class="o">.</span><span class="n">from_object</span><span class="p">(</span><span class="s">&quot;bitshift.config&quot;</span><span class="p">)</span>\n</span>\n<span class="hll"><span class="n">app_env</span> <span class="o">=</span> <span class="n">app</span><span class="o">.</span><span class="n">jinja_env</span>\n</span><span class="hll"><span class="n">app_env</span><span class="o">.</span><span class="n">line_statement_prefix</span> <span class="o">=</span> <span class="s">&quot;=&quot;</span>\n</span><span class="hll"><span class="n">app_env</span><span class="o">.</span><span class="n">globals</span><span class="o">.</span><span class="n">update</span><span class="p">(</span><span class="n">assets</span><span class="o">=</span><span class="n">assets</span><span class="p">)</span>\n</span>\n<span class="c"># database = Database()</span>\n\n<span class="hll"><span class="nd">@app.route</span><span class="p">(</span><span class="s">&quot;/&quot;</span><span class="p">)</span>\n</span><span class="k">def</span> <span class="nf">index</span><span class="p">():</span>\n <span class="k">return</span> <span class="n">render_template</span><span class="p">(</span><span class="s">&quot;index.html&quot;</span><span class="p">)</span>\n\n<span class="hll"><span class="nd">@app.route</span><span class="p">(</span><span class="s">&quot;/search/&lt;query&gt;&quot;</span><span class="p">)</span>\n</span><span class="k">def</span> <span class="nf">search</span><span class="p">(</span><span class="n">query</span><span class="p">):</span>\n <span class="c"># tree = parse_query(query)</span>\n <span class="c"># database.search(tree)</span>\n <span class="k">pass</span>\n\n<span class="hll"><span class="nd">@app.route</span><span class="p">(</span><span class="s">&quot;/about&quot;</span><span class="p">)</span>\n</span><span class="k">def</span> <span class="nf">about</span><span class="p">():</span>\n <span class="k">return</span> <span class="n">render_template</span><span class="p">(</span><span class="s">&quot;about.html&quot;</span><span class="p">)</span>\n\n<span class="hll"><span class="nd">@app.route</span><span class="p">(</span><span class="s">&quot;/developers&quot;</span><span class="p">)</span>\n</span><span class="k">def</span> <span class="nf">developers</span><span class="p">():</span>\n <span class="k">return</span> <span class="n">render_template</span><span class="p">(</span><span class="s">&quot;developers.html&quot;</span><span class="p">)</span>\n\n<span class="k">if</span> <span class="n">__name__</span> <span class="o">==</span> <span class="s">&quot;__main__&quot;</span><span class="p">:</span>\n<span class="hll"> <span class="n">app</span><span class="o">.</span><span class="n">run</span><span class="p">(</span><span class="n">debug</span><span class="o">=</span><span class="bp">True</span><span class="p">)</span>\n</span></pre></div>\n</td></tr></table>'
searchBar.onkeyup = typingTimer;

var testCodelet = {
'url': 'https://github.com/earwig/bitshift/blob/develop/app.py',


+ 4
- 0
static/sass/_mixins.sass Parādīt failu

@@ -15,6 +15,10 @@
@include vendor(opacity, $opacity)
filter: alpha(opacity=$opacity)

@mixin delay($time)
transition-delay: $time
-webkit-transition-delay: $time

.t1
@include vendor(transition, all 0.1s ease-out)



+ 10
- 8
static/sass/about.sass Parādīt failu

@@ -9,28 +9,30 @@
z-index: -1

&#img-1
background: url("../img/about/bg1.png") no-repeat
background: url(../img/about/bg1.png) no-repeat
background-size: cover
height: 400px
top: 0px

&#img-2
background: url("../img/about/bg2.png") no-repeat
height: $img-height
top: 480px
background: url(../img/about/bg2.png) no-repeat
height: $img-height + 250px
top: 520px

&#img-3
background: url("../img/about/bg3.png") no-repeat
background: url(../img/about/bg3.png) no-repeat
background-size: cover
height: $img-height + 200
top: 1200px
height: $img-height + 250
top: 1800px

div.section
background-color: white
border: 1px solid $baseColor2
height: 300px
margin-bottom: 200px
margin-top: 300px
padding: 20px
padding-bottom: 50px
padding-top: 20px

&#top
margin-top: 0px


+ 9
- 3
static/sass/main.sass Parādīt failu

@@ -30,15 +30,21 @@ div#container

div#footer
@extend .t3
@include delay(1s)

background-color: $baseColor1
bottom: 0
bottom: -30px
height: 60px
padding-top: 12px
position: absolute
padding-top: 15px
position: fixed
text-align: center
width: 100%

&:hover
@include delay(0s)

bottom: 0

*
color: white



Notiek ielāde…
Atcelt
Saglabāt